Laura Mortenson

LICSW

Laura is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ker, and has spent nearly two decades providing guidance and support to individuals dealing with the many different types of grief and loss. She has an expansive understanding of the surprising and often unacknowledged ways each one of us is touched by grief and loss as we journey through our lives, and she is keenly aware of how various types of losses, such as ambiguous loss, disenfranchised loss, and traumatic loss can at times feel overwhelming and isolating. She has a strong interest in hearing each person tell their own story and firmly believes that each individual comes in as the expert in their own life and has the potential to learn and incorporate skills that will allow them to work through challenges in a healthy and productive way.

 

In addition to Grief and Loss, Laura works with those struggling with anxiety, depression, ADHD, OCD, PTSD, as well as those navigating challenging life circumstances and interpersonal relationships. Laura uses a client centered and strength-based approach, meeting clients where they are at, utilizing therapeutic modalities that best fit each client such as; narrative therapy, mindfulness, DBT and CBT skills. 

 

Laura graduated from Wheaton College with a BA in Literature and received her MSW from College of St Catherine/University of St Thomas.
